WebEach Myofibril is composed of numerous sarcomere s, the functional contracile region of a striated muscle. Sarcomeres, in turn, are composed of myofilaments of myosin and actin, which interact using the sliding filament model ( powered by molecular motors) and cross-bridge cycle to contract. [1] [2] Key Terms WebA sarcomere is defined as the distance between the Z-lines. The Z-lines are pulled closer together during contraction and move further apart during relaxation. The Z-lines are closer during contraction because actin and myosin interaction generates cross-bridges, which slide the myofilaments over each other.

WebApr 9, 2024 · The myofilaments are organised into repeated subunits along the length of the myofibrils. These subunits are called the sarcomeres. Myofibrils fill the muscle cells which run parallel to each other on the long axis of the cell. WebThe sarcomere is a regular repeated structures consisting of thick and thin filaments, present in the myofibrils of muscle fibers. The repeated pattern of sarcomeres gives skeletal muscle its striated, or striped, appearance.
